单选题The food we eat seems to have profound effects on our health. Although science has made enormous steps in making food more fit to eat, it has, at the same time, made many foods unfit to eat. Some research has shown that perhaps eighty percent of all human illnesses are related to diet and forty percent of cancer is related to the diet as well, especially cancer of the colon (结肠). Different cultures are prone (易于……的) to contract (染上疾病等) certain illnesses because of the food that is characteristic (特有的) in these cultures. That food is related to illness is not a new discovery. Farmers often give penicillin to beef and poultry, and because of this, penicillin has been found in the milk of treated cows. Sometimes similar drugs are given to animals not for medicinal purposes, but for financial reasons. The farmers are simply trying to fatten the animals in order to obtain a higher price on the market. Although the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has tried repeatedly to control these procedures, the practices continue.

单选题Real policemen hardly recognize any resemblance (类同之处) between their lives and what they see on TV—if they ever get home in time. There are similarities, of course, but the cops (警官)don't think much of them. The first difference is that a policeman's real life revolves round the law. Most of his training is in criminal law. He has to know exactly what actions are crimes and what evidence can be used to prove them in court, He has to know nearly as much law as a professional lawyer, and What is more, he has to apply it on his feet, in the dark and rain, running down an alley after someone he wants to talk to. Little of his time is spent in chatting to pretty girls and beautiful women or in dramatic (戏剧性的) confrontations with desperate criminals. He will spend most of his working life typing millions of words on thousands of forms about hundreds of sad, unimportant people who are guilt—or not—of stupid, petty (不重要的) crimes,

When I started school my classmates made it clear to me how I must look to others: a little girl with an ugly lip. And I was deaf in one ear. I was sure that no one outside my family could love me. Then I entered Mrs. Green's second-grade class. Mrs. Green was round and pretty. Everyone loved her. But no one came to love her more than I did. And for a special reason. The time came for the annual(一年一度的) hearing test given at our school. The "whisper test" required each child to go to the classroom door, turn sideways, close one ear with a finger, while the teacher whispered something from the desk, which the child repeated. Then the same for the other ear. The teacher usually whispered things like "The sky is blue. " or "Do you have new shoes?". My time came. I turned my bad ear toward her, blocking the other just enough to be able to hear. I waited, and then came the words that God had surely put into her mouth, seven words that changed my life forever. She said softly, "I wish you were my little girl. "

单选题 As working women continue to receive better and better wages, housewives still work at home without receiving paychecks. Should a woman who works at home, doing the housework and caring for children, be paid for her services? In a 1986 study at Cornell University, it was found that the value of the services of a housewife averaged $11,600 is what the husband would have to pay if he hired others to take over his wife's household work. The researchers concluded that it would be fair for husbands to pay wives according to government guidelines (方针) for least amounts of wages. Another plan for rewarding women who work at home has been suggested by Dr. Johnson, a former Secretary of Health and Human Services. He says that full-time housewives should be allowed to pay social security taxes (社会保障金), with their employers (that is, their husbands) offering part of the payment. He feels that the present system is unfair. He said, "If you work in a store you can qualify for Social Security, but if you stay at home and raise a family, you can't qualify for it."

单选题When we are speaking face-to-face with someone, how do we understand the meaning of the other person"s speech? By the words that the other person uses, of course! This is true, but it is not the whole truth. According to some experts, comprehension(理解) of another person"s speech includes more than the actual words. In fact, they say that the actual words contribute only between seven percent and ten percent to our understanding of the message. In addition, such things as intonation (声调), rate of speech and non-word sounds also contribute to our comprehension.
